Default First HUSH Post, 5/10 hand.

MP is LAG (54/27), but is not that crazy postflop. CO is TAG (based on a small sample), no strong reads on him.

Party Poker 5/10 Hold'em (6 max, 6 handed) converter

Preflop: Hero is UTG with J[img]/images/graemlins/heart.gif[/img], Q[img]/images/graemlins/heart.gif[/img].
<font color="#CC3333">Hero raises</font>, <font color="#CC3333">MP 3-bets</font>, <font color="#CC3333">CO caps</font>, <font color="#666666">3 folds</font>, Hero calls, MP calls.

Flop: (13.40 SB) 6[img]/images/graemlins/diamond.gif[/img], 2[img]/images/graemlins/heart.gif[/img], Q[img]/images/graemlins/club.gif[/img] <font color="#0000FF">(3 players)</font>

Maybe I should have folded preflop... but I didn't, so give me a line.

Tough preflop decision when it's two back to you. I really don't know which is correct, given that you say CO may be a TAG and therefore his range of capping hands probably have you dominated. But, you are getting a likely 6:1 to call, and guaranteed action postflop, and you said your sample size on CO is small.


On the flop, go for the check-raise: it'll work 99% of the time here.



Play thereafter will depend on what happens ....

I go for a checkraise on the flop. If MP bets/CO calls or visa versa I raise. If you get 3-bet by either I call and fold turn ui against tag, call down agasint lag. If MP bets CO raises I make a crying fold.

On the turn, if your checkraise worked, I lead any none ace or king flop, unless the ace or king is a heart. If raised I call and fold river ui. If ace or king hits, I check-call down. If checked behind on turn, I bet/call hu and check 3 way.

I like the C/R on the flop for the very reason that you showed: If it comes back 2 to you, its an easy fold. If you are able to C/R w/o a 3-bet you likely have best hand or are getting C/R on the turn by an overpair(by a tricky player). I think the C/R is the best line since you called the PF cap.

Given the line you took, fold the flop when it's two back to you. And given that there's a LAG to your left, I probably avoid open-raising UTG in a 6-handed game with marginal stuff like QJs. It's pretty to look at, but not the kind of hand you want to get isolated with. Tough to play it out of position unless your very comfy vs LAGs. (Actually, tough regardless.)

5-handed I still open-raise with it, but 6-handed . . . I lean towards dumping it.
